一、引言
在互联网时代,开源已经成为一种趋势,而源码作为软件开发的核心,其质量和安全性显得尤为重要。在付费下载资源中挑选优质且安全的源码,对于开发者来说,是至关重要的。本文将详细介绍如何从多个维度进行挑选,以确保所下载的源码既具备高质量又具有高度的安全性。
二、明确需求
要明确自己的需求。明确项目的需求和目标,这有助于筛选出符合需求的源码。从源码的类型、功能、技术要求、行业特点等多个角度进行综合分析,以确保筛选出的源码能满足项目的基本需求。
三、源码的质量考量
1. 代码规范性:检查代码的命名、缩进、注释等规范性因素,规范性的代码更易于阅读和维护。
2. 模块化程度:一个优质的源码应该有明确的模块划分,各个模块之间的耦合度低,内聚度高。
3. 性能优化:关注代码的性能优化情况,包括算法优化、内存管理等方面的内容。
4. 文档齐全:完善的文档能够为开发者提供方便的开发和维护指导。
5. 代码可读性:关注代码的可读性,可读性好的代码能提高开发效率。
四、安全性考量
1. 代码审查:通过代码审查可以发现潜在的安全隐患,包括但不限于SQL注入、跨站脚本攻击(XSS)等。
2. 加密措施:关注源码中是否采取了必要的加密措施,如密码加密、数据传输加密等。
3. 更新与维护:一个好的源码应该有良好的更新与维护机制,以便及时修复安全漏洞。
4. 社区支持:关注源码所在的社区活跃度,社区的活跃度可以反映源码的受欢迎程度以及安全性问题解决的速度。
五、来源可靠性
1. 选择知名厂商或开发团队的源码,他们的源码质量往往更有保障。
2. 查看源码的下载量、评价等信息,以判断其受欢迎程度和可靠性。
3. 了解源码的授权方式,避免因授权问题导致的法律纠纷。
4. 关注源码的更新情况,一个经常更新的源码往往更具有活力和安全性。
六、付费与免费的选择
在付费与免费的选择上,开发者需要根据项目需求和预算进行权衡。虽然免费资源可以节省成本,但可能存在质量不稳定、安全性无法保障等问题。而付费资源通常能提供更好的质量保证和安全保障,但也需要根据预算进行选择。在选择时,可以综合考虑资源的性价比、服务质量等因素。
七、实际测试与验证
在实际应用中,对挑选的源码进行实际测试与验证是必不可少的步骤。通过实际测试,可以验证源码的功能是否符合需求、性能是否达到预期、是否存在潜在的安全问题等。同时,也可以通过实际使用来验证源码的可靠性和稳定性。
八、结语
挑选优质且安全的源码需要从多个维度进行考虑和分析。明确需求、考虑源码的质量和安全性、关注来源可靠性、权衡付费与免费的选择以及进行实际测试与验证都是必不可少的步骤。通过这些步骤的实践和总结,我们可以更好地挑选出符合项目需求的优质且安全的源码。在这个过程中,关键词包括:需求明确、质量考量、安全性考量、来源可靠性、付费与免费选择、实际测试与验证等。这些关键词是我们在挑选优质且安全的源码过程中需要关注和考虑的重要方面。







